7 Types of Invoice Templates: Sales, Service, and Billing for Business
Blog
11 Mar 2024
Updated on 24 Sep 2025

A poorly structured invoice doesn’t just look unprofessional, but it can damage your business’s reputation, delay payments, and ultimately impact your cash flow. 

 

Many businesses make avoidable invoice mistakes, from rigid formats to unclear language and incomplete details. These errors may cause client confusion and lead to significant payment delays. Considering that 82% of small business failures stem from cash flow issues, improving your invoicing process is a must.  

 

The same research also indicates that many businesses are seeking ways to address this challenge, one of which is through more efficient invoice payment collection. The above data demonstrates the importance of effective financial management for business continuity and growth. 

 

This is where a well-designed invoice plays a vital role. It serves not only as a transaction document but also as a strategic tool for managing healthy cash flow. Let’s dive into why invoice documents matter for business and explore invoice template examples that suit various business types. 

 

Why Invoices Are Crucial for Business Growth  

An invoice isn't just a request for payment, but it's a strategic component of your financial operations. Here are some key reasons your business should prioritize professional invoices: 

 

1. Strengthens Business Professionalism 

A clean, branded invoice template tells clients you’re serious about your business. It builds credibility and helps establish long-term relationships with customers who appreciate transparency and attention to detail. 

 

pembuatan invoice di kantor

 

 

2. Ensure Accurate Financial Records

Invoices are essential tools for recording income and tracking sales. When organized properly, they simplify audits, help manage taxes and ensure accurate bookkeeping. 

 

3. Speeds Up Payments

When clients receive a clear and detailed billing invoice, they’re less likely to delay payments. Including due dates, accepted payment methods, and reference numbers encourages prompt action. 

 

4. Provides Legal Protection

An invoice acts as a legally recognized document in case of disputes. Whether it's a service invoice or a donation receipt, having a formal record protects both parties. 

 

5. Keeps Your Cash Flow Healthy

Prompt invoicing helps you maintain a stable cash flow. This allows you to plan budgets, invest in resources, and keep operations running smoothly. 

 

6. Strengthen Customer Relationships 

Transparent and well-timed invoices create a better client experience, showing reliability and building long-term business partnerships. 

 

invoice yang dibayar tepat waktu dapat memperlancar cash flow

 

7 Invoice Templates for Business Transactions

Different types of transactions call for different kinds of invoices. Below are seven practical examples tailored to various business models, complete with formatting tips and downloadable ideas for your own use. 

 

1. Product Sales Invoice

Ideal for retail or wholesale businesses, this invoice details the products sold, quantities, unit prices, and applicable taxes.

 

Example:

 

Invoice #12345  

Date: January 19, 2024 

 

From:

PT Maju Terus Jl. Kembangan No. 10, Jakarta Tel: 021-123456 Email: info@majuterus.com 

 

To

Toko Bunga Indah  

Melati Street No. 5, Bandung 

 

No Item Name Quantity Unit Price Total Price
1 Ceramic Flower Vase  50 IDR 100.000 IDR 5.000.000
2 Organic Fertilizer 100 IDR 50.000 IDR 5.000.000

 

Subtotal: IDR 10.000.000 
Tax (11%): IDR 1.100.000 
Total: IDR 11.100.000  

 

Note: 

  • Payment is due within 30 days of receipt of the invoice. 

  • Payment can be made by bank transfer to BCA account 123-456-789 in the name of PT Maju Terus. 

 

2. Service Payment Invoice

This service invoice format is perfect for consultants, freelancers, or service-based businesses that charge by the hour or by project scope. 

 

Example: 

 

Invoice #67890  

Date: January 15, 2024 

 

From:  

Studio Desain Kreatif  

Creative Street No. 20, Surabaya Tel: 031-654321 Email: hello[at]studiokreatif[dot]com 

 

To:  

Cafe Sejuk  

Rindang Street No. 3, Malang 

 

No Service Type Duration (hours) Rate per Hour Total Price 
1 Interior Design  30 IDR 200.000 IDR 6.000.000
2 Design Consultation  5 IDR 150.000 IDR 750.000

 

Subtotal: IDR 6.750.000  

Tax (11%): IDR 742.500  

Total: IDR 7.492.500 

 

Note:  

  • Payment is due within 14 days of receipt of the invoice.  

  • Payment can be made by bank transfer to Mandiri account at 987-654-321 in the name of Creative Design Studio. 

 

3. Online Sales Invoice

For e-commerce or online store transactions, this payment invoice includes itemized details, shipping costs, and return policy reminders.

 

Example: 

 

Invoice #90123

Date: January 12, 2024 

 

From:

Butik Online Elegan 

Web www[dot]butikelegan[dot]com  

Email: customer[at]butikelegan[dot]com 

 

To:  

Mrs. Sari Rahayu  

Anggrek Street No. 7, Yogyakarta 

 

No Product Name Quantity  Unit Price  Total Price
1 Long Dress 1 IDR 500.000 IDR 500.000
2 High Heels Shoes 1 IDR 750.000 IDR 750.000

 

Subtotal: IDR 1.250.000  

Shipping: IDR 50.000  

Total: IDR 1.300.000 

 

Note:  

  • Prices include tax. Payment is due within 7 days of receipt of the invoice.  

  • Payment can be made by bank transfer to BNI account 321-098-765 in the name of Butik Online Elegan.  

  • Send proof of payment to customer[at]butikelegan[dot]com with the invoice number in the subject line. 

 

4, Subscription Billing Invoice

Use this billing invoice format for recurring services, like SaaS, streaming, or membership. 

 

Example: 

 

Invoice #45678  

Date: January 17, 2024 

 

From:  

Melodi Music Streaming 

Web: www[dot]melodi[dot]com 

Email: support[at]melodi[dot]com 

 

To:  

Mr. Rudi Hartono 

Jambu Street No. 12, Medan 

 

No Subscription Type  Period  Price 
1 Premium Subscription  Feb 2024 IDR 150.000

 

Subtotal: IDR 150.000 

Tax (11%): IDR 16.500  

Total: IDR 166.500 

 

Note:  

  • Payment must be made before January 31, 2024, to retain access.  

  • Payment can be made by bank transfer to CIMB Niaga account 765-321-098 in the name of Melodi Music Streaming Services. 

 

5. Installment Payment Invoice

When payments are made in stages, this invoice tracks how much have been paid, and what's left, perfect for large purchases. 

 

Example: 

 

Invoice #56789  

Date: January 15, 2024 

 

From:  

Dealer Mobil Cepat  

Diponegoro Street No. 88, Semarang 

Email: sales[at]dealercepat[dot]com 

 

To: 

Mr. Andi Setiawan 
Merdeka Street No. 23, Sol 

 

No Installment Description Total Installments  Total Price Installment No.  Amount Paid 
1 Honda Civic Car Installment  12 IDR 360.000.000 1 IDR 30.000.000

 

Subtotal: IDR30.000.000 

Tax (11%): IDR 3.300.000  

Total Due: IDR 33.300.000 

 

Note:  

  • First installment payment.  

  • Payment can be made by bank transfer to BRI account 098-765-4321 in the name of Fast Car Dealer. 

 

6. Project-Based Invoice

Often used by agencies or contractors, this project invoice breaks down time spent, scope, and project phases. 

 

Example: 

 

Invoice #78901  

Date: January 11, 2024 

 

From:  

MegaProyek Construction  

Industri Street No. 5, Bekasi 

Email: kontak[at]megaproyek[dot]com 

 

To:  

PT Bina Bangunan  

Teknologi Street No. 10, Tangerang 

 

No Work Description Duration (days) Rate per Day  Total Price 
1 Office Building Construction 30 IDR 5.000.000 IDR 150.000.000

 

Subtotal: IDR 150.000.000 

Tax (11%): IDR 16.500.000  

Total: IDR 166.500.000 

 

Note:  

  • Invoice for the first phase of the project.  

  • Payment can be made by bank transfer to Danamon account 4321-098-765 in the name of MegaProyek Building Contractor. 

 

7. Donation Invoice 

Used by non-profits, this type of invoice acts as a tax-friendly record for contributors. 

 

Example: 

 

Invoice #81234  

Date: January 18, 2024 

 

From:  

Yayasan Peduli Lingkungan 

Hijau Street No. 21, Denpasar 

Email: donasi[at]pedulilingkungan[dot]org 

 

To: 

Mrs. Rina Suryani 

Sunyi Street No. 8, Jakarta 

 

No Donation Description Amount 
1 Tree Planting Donation IDR 2.000.000

 

Total Donation: IDR 2.000.000 

Tax: IDR 0 (Not applicable)  

Total: IDR 2.000.000 

 

Note:  

  • Thank you for your contribution to the Environmental Care Foundation.  

  • Your donation helps us preserve the environment and plant trees in various areas.  

  • This donation can be used as a tax deduction in accordance with applicable regulations. 

 

Donation Account Information:  

BNI Bank Account No.: 123-456-789  

In the Name of: Yayasan Peduli Lingkungan 

 

Each of the invoice examples above has specific elements that must be considered to align with the type of transaction and business needs. 

 

Tips to Create a Better Invoice Template

Want to optimize your invoice template and speed up your payment cycle? Here are smart practices to follow: 

 

1. Use a Consistent Format

Consistency is key in invoice design. Use the same template for all your invoices, including logo, color scheme, and layout. This not only creates a professional image but also makes it easier for recipients to recognize and process their invoices. 

 

2. Include Full Contact Details

Be sure to include complete contact information for you and the recipient of the invoice. This includes name, address, phone number, and email address. Clear and complete information facilitates communication if there are questions or issues related to the invoice. 

 

3. Offer Multiple Payment Options

Providing multiple payment options can make payments easier for your customers. Include bank account information, online payments, or other methods you accept. This demonstrates flexibility and convenience for customers. 

 

4. Send Invoices Promptly

Sending invoices as soon as the product or service is delivered ensures that the transaction is fresh in the customer's mind. It also helps expedite the payment process and maintains a healthy cash flow. 

 

5. Follow Tax Compliance

Ensure that your invoices comply with applicable tax regulations. This includes including relevant tax information and ensuring that the tax rate applied (such as 11%) is current and in accordance with regulations. 

Conclusion 

A professionally designed invoice plays a vital role in your business’s financial ecosystem. Whether you're sending a service invoice, billing statement, or payment invoice, your document should reflect accuracy, transparency, and trust. 

 

Understanding the various invoice formats, like those shown above, helps you tailor each one to your transaction type. The result? Faster payments, better cash flow, and stronger relationships with your clients. 

 

If you're looking for a smart way to manage your finances, consider using Pembukuan Digital by Telkomsel Enterprise, an all-in-one solution for UMKM owners to track income, generate invoices, and manage debts effortlessly. 

 

With automated invoicing and financial reporting, even non-accountants can manage their books confidently. 

 

Looking for a better way to streamline your business invoicing? Contact Telkomsel Enterprise today and discover how Digital Accounting can revolutionize your cash flow. 

TAGS
Blog

Our site uses cookies to improve your experience. By continuing, you have agreed to the applicable Terms & Conditions and Privacy Policy.